Erectile Dysfunction

What is erectile dysfunction (ED)?

Erectile dysfunction (ED) is the inability to get or keep an erection firm enough to have sexual intercourse. It’s also sometimes referred to as impotence.

Occasional ED isn’t uncommon. Many men experience it during times of stress. Frequent ED can be a sign of health problems that need treatment. It can also be a sign of emotional or relationship difficulties that may need to be addressed by a professional.

Not all male sexual problems are caused by ED. Other types of male sexual dysfunction include:
  • premature ejaculation
  • delayed or absent ejaculation
  • lack of interest in sex
What are the symptoms of ED?

trouble getting an erection

difficulty maintaining an erection during sexual activities

reduced interest in sex

Other sexual disorders related to ED include:

premature ejaculation

delayed ejaculation

anorgasmia, which is the inability to achieve orgasm after ample stimulation You should talk to your doctor if you have any of these symptoms, especially if they’ve lasted for two or more months. Your doctor can determine if your sexual disorder is caused by an underlying condition that requires treatment.

What causes ED?

There are many possible causes for ED, and they can include both emotional and physical disorders. Some common causes are:s

  • cardiovascular disease
  • diabetes
  • hypertension
  • hyperlipidemia
  • damage from cancer or surgery
  • injuries
  • obesity or being overweight
  • increased age
  • stress
  • anxiety
  • relationship problems
  • drug use
  • alcohol use
  • smoking

ED can be caused by only one of these factors or several. That’s why it’s important to work with your doctor so that they can rule out or treat any underlying medical conditions.
